About Callie
Callie needs a generous soul with the patience to win her over. She has the potential to be a loving pet, but it will take her some time. Having raised 3 litters of her own in a supported colony, Callie came into our care along with her 4th litter of 4 kittens. She also adopted 4 more who had been separated from their Mum. She has done a great job & we would love to see her rewarded with her very own furever home.... but you will need to be prepared for the possibility that she may take a long time to take you up on an invitation to curl up on your lap. It might not happen at all... BUT she has shown amazing potential and seems to want to learn how to be loved by people. Please give Callie a chance if you are able to.
